HVAC roof flashing is the installation or repair of metal components around rooftop HVAC units to prevent water intrusion. This page covers hvac roof flashing for buildings in Sarasota, Florida.

Metal roofing and fabrication in Sarasota, Florida, must contend with the persistent challenges of a coastal environment. The proximity to the Gulf of Mexico means constant exposure to salt air, which can accelerate corrosion on certain metals. Additionally, the region is susceptible to hurricane-force winds and heavy rainfall, requiring robust installation methods and materials designed to withstand extreme weather. High humidity and intense solar heat are also daily factors impacting both the longevity of metalwork and the comfort of building occupants.

What to keep in mind locally

  • Coastal corrosion resistance is paramount; select materials specifically rated for marine or high-salt environments.
  • Ensure all installations meet or exceed local building codes for wind uplift resistance, especially in hurricane-prone areas.
  • Consider the thermal expansion and contraction of metal due to Sarasota’s significant temperature fluctuations and intense sun.
  • Proper ventilation is crucial to manage humidity and prevent condensation, which can lead to issues under metal roofing and cladding.

What the work involves

This service involves fabricating and installing custom-fit metal flashing, typically made of aluminum, galvanized steel, or copper, around the base and penetrations of HVAC units. The flashing is integrated with the roofing system to create a watertight seal, directing water away from the unit and the roof deck.

When this comes up

  • When a new HVAC unit is installed on the roof.
  • When existing roof flashing around an HVAC unit is damaged or deteriorated.
  • When the roofing system is being replaced and requires updated flashing for HVAC penetrations.
  • To address leaks or water damage originating from around a rooftop HVAC unit.
